Anniversary Afternoon Tea at The Langham Boston
Once a year, The Langham hotels celebrate their anniversary by serving afternoon tea service for the original price that the first Langham hotel in London charged. Back in 1865, afternoon tea was 1 shilling and 6 pence. That means, dear readers, that on June 10 you can get the $38 afternoon tea at The Langham in Boston for only $0.15!

I tried their special Boston blend which is black tea with cranberry and almond.
Finger sandwiches included the ubiquitous cucumber sandwich, salmon rillette, chicken salad sandwich, and a mini crab puff. Each plate you see on this post is for two people.
I forgot to take a photo of the scones (sorry), but there were clotted cream, lemon curd, and jam to accompany.
After the sandwiches and devouring two warm scones each, we were pretty full. I could barely finish the plate of pink treats. There were chocolate dipped strawberries, a raspberry tart, a chocolate cupcake, and macarons.
